Lifetime is launching the all-new unscripted series America’s Supernanny, marking the first true U.S. version of the hit global format that will feature an American homegrown nanny. The producers of America’s SuperNanny are searching the country to find a dynamic, caring and credentialed woman to star in the new series.
If you’re a nanny, a teacher, a parenting coach, a child psychologist or another type of viable family specialist, apply by emailing nannysearch@shedmediaus.com with a completed application, photo & resume.
The deadline to apply is Aug. 30th. Applications can be found at www.shedmediaus.com or by clicking on this link.
FAMILIES needing the help of “America’s Supernanny”, email Supernanny@shedmediaus.comor or call 877-NANNY-TIME.
ABOUT:
No family issue should be too trivial or intimidating for America’s Supernanny, who will visit the homes of parents throughout the country seeking guidance and assistance on how to best raise their children. Diving straight into the chaos and heart of the matter, America’s Supernanny will give viewers an all-access look at troubled households by closely observing each family dynamic to pinpoint their complicated problems – ranging from extremely intense tantrums and constant timeouts to bad habits and misguided parenting – and follow through to resolve their issues to put families on the road to happiness.
“The importance of family and childcare is key to women and we are constantly looking to provide programming that involves what’s important to them,” said Dubuc. “This program will do just that and showcase America’s Supernanny’s approach and experience to not only entertain parents and their children, but also help them work through any problems they might have.”
“Shed Media US is thrilled to work with Lifetime on re-launching our successful brand with a fresh, new, American nanny,” said Nick Emmerson, President of Shed Media US.
Lifetime has ordered eight one-hour episodes of America’s Supernanny, which will be produced by Shed Media U.S. by Nick Emmerson and Stephanie Schwam, with Rob Sharenow, Gena McCarthy and Jim Rapsas of Lifetime executive producing.
A global hit, Supernanny has been formatted throughout the world, including Belgium, Brazil, China, France, Greece, Holland, Indonesia, Israel, Italy, Germany, Malaysia, Romania, Singapore, Spain and Sweden.

About Vicky Boone in her own words: I am a native Texan, born and raised in the Houston area. I have worked professionally with actors and directors in Texas since 1982. In 2004, I began casting films and commercials. In recent years, I’ve served as casting director on such projects as Terrence Malick’s The Tree of Life (producer Sarah Green), Spike Jonze’s Scenes from the Suburbs (producer Vince Landay), David Riker’sThe Girl (producer Paul Mezey) and Steve Collins’ Gretchen (producers Jay Van Hoy, Lars Knudsen and Anish Savjani). I also work with many central Texas production companies casting commercials and industrials.
Prior to beginning a career in casting, I worked professionally as a theater director and producer for 15 years, directing over 50 plays and producing many more. Specializing in new play development, I worked at the Empty Space Theatre (Seattle), the Playwrights’ Center (Minneapolis), the Sundance Theatre Lab (Utah), the Alley Theatre (Houston), the Guthrie Theatre (Minneapolis), the Dallas Theatre Center and Dallas Shakespeare Festival. For ten years I ran the critically acclaimed Austin theatre, Frontera Productions and produced the annual fringe performance festival, FronteraFest.
I have directed two short films, Attack of the Bride Monster (2005) and Adventure Story (2003) which have screened at over 60 festivals internationally including The Hamptons Int’l Film Festival, Palm Springs Int’l Short Film Festival, The Provincetown Film Festival and the Seoul Int’l Woman’s Film Festival.
I taught acting and directing at St. Edward’s University (Austin) and the University of Texas. I hold an MFA in Directing from Boston University School for the Arts and a BA in Theater from Texas A&M University.
